Since 1998, the Ohio Credit Union Foundation has profoundly impacted individuals and families located in communities where credit unions serve. The Foundation is a proud credit union partner supporting educational and outreach initiatives that promote financial independence through credit unions. In addition, the Foundation has donated $581,576 for disaster relief globally.

We recognize that the past eighteen months have created many challenges for credit unions beyond our challenges at the Foundation. However, thanks to our dedicated members, we have continued serving and raising funds. Corporate sponsorships, individual gifts, participation at special events, and other fundraisers drive our grantmaking. One hundred percent of the funds raised are put back into credit union communities.
